Stick to the basics...

 

There’s no getting around the fact that Covid-19 has almost completely upended the world. After nearly 6 months of this, we each need to settle down, assess our own circumstances and options, and create an environment that is driven by as much of what we can control as possible. We can’t ignore this… period. I recently talked to a business owner friend who told me how his operation is drifting, and his key people are all fighting amongst themselves and with him: when I asked him whether he is practicing good communications and is open and transparent… he went into a long list of excuses why he hasn’t. I stopped him and said there’s no substitute for effective leadership… ever. In these extraordinary times, it’s important to invest in and maintain the relationships that make us who and what we are – personally and professionally. If you’re leading a business (or anything else), your efforts and actions should be driven by the basics of effective management and leadership. That’s the best way to get the most out of your personal and professional relationships and responsibilities today.
